Re: How can I keep my indoor cat stay indoors?!

I know just what you're going through , i have 4 Ragdolls myself and one of them only has to see the door open and he makes a sprint for it lol, Cat proofing your garden is about the best way, here i built an 18ft run and attached it to a garden shed and they use it as a cat house , in the summer or when its warm they will be waiting at the dorr to go out there they really do love it and they have loads of toys and things to keep them playing , but cat proofing has to be the safest way , good luck ............chris
